homescreenapp/serviceproviders/hsmenuserviceprovider/src/hsmenuservice.cpp
changeset 69 87476091b3f5
parent 63 52b0f64eeb51
child 71 1db7cc813a4e
--- a/homescreenapp/serviceproviders/hsmenuserviceprovider/src/hsmenuservice.cpp	Wed Jul 14 15:53:30 2010 +0300
+++ b/homescreenapp/serviceproviders/hsmenuserviceprovider/src/hsmenuservice.cpp	Fri Jul 23 13:47:57 2010 +0300
@@ -34,7 +34,7 @@
 
 // Initialization of a static member variable.
 int HsMenuService::mAllCollectionsId = 0;
-
+const char COLLECTION_TITLE_NAME[] = "title_name";
 /*!
  Returns all applications model
  \param sortAttribute ::  SortAttribute
@@ -236,6 +236,7 @@
     CaEntry collection(GroupEntryRole);
     collection.setEntryTypeName(collectionTypeName());
     collection.setText(name);
+	collection.setAttribute(COLLECTION_TITLE_NAME, name);
     collection.setAttribute(groupNameAttributeName(),name);
     CaIconDescription iconDescription;
     iconDescription.setFilename(defaultCollectionIconId());
@@ -270,6 +271,7 @@
                  << collection;
 
         collection->setText(newCollectionName);
+        collection->setAttribute(COLLECTION_TITLE_NAME, newCollectionName);
         result = CaService::instance()->updateEntry(*collection);
     }
     HSMENUTEST_FUNC_EXIT("HsMenuService::renameCollection");